How much do professional rideshare driver j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for professional rideshare driver in Grand Rapids, MN is $16.46,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.52 and $17.93 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ges professional rideshare drivers face, and how can they effectively manage them?

Professional Rideshare Drivers often encounter challenges such as fluctuating demand, navigating unfamiliar areas, and maintaining high customer ratings. To manage these, drivers can use in-app features to identify peak hours and popular locations, familiarize themselves with local maps, and provide courteous, timely service to passengers. Regular vehicle maintenance and clear communication with riders also contribute to a smoother experience and higher satisfaction, helping drivers build a strong reputation and maximize earnings.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a professional rideshare driver?

To thrive as a Professional Rideshare Driver, you need a valid driver's license, a clean driving record, and a thorough knowledge of local traffic laws and routes. Familiarity with rideshare apps (such as Uber or Lyft), GPS navigation systems, and sometimes vehicle inspection or background check processes is typically required. Excellent customer service, communication, and time management skills help drivers stand out and ensure positive passenger experiences. These skills and qualifications are crucial for providing safe, efficient, and reliable transportation while maintaining high customer ratings and job security.

What is the difference between Professional Rideshare Driver vs Taxi Driver?

AspectProfessional Rideshare DriverTaxi Driver
CredentialsDriver's license, background check, vehicle registrationDriver's license, taxi license or permit, background check
Work EnvironmentRideshare app-based, flexible hours, personal vehicleMedallion or permit-based, often fixed shifts, taxi vehicle
Employer & Industry UsageWorks independently via rideshare platforms like Uber/LyftWorks for taxi companies or independently with a taxi license

Both roles involve transporting passengers, but a Professional Rideshare Driver typically operates their own vehicle through app-based platforms with flexible hours, while a Taxi Driver often works for a taxi company or with a licensed taxi vehicle, sometimes with fixed shifts. The credentials overlap but differ slightly in licensing requirements. Understanding these differences helps in choosing the right career path in the transportation industry.

What is a professional rideshare driver?

Professional rideshare drivers are individuals who use their personal or leased vehicles to transport passengers through app-based platforms like Uber or Lyft. They pick up and drop off riders at requested locations, ensuring safe and efficient travel. These drivers are typically considered independent contractors and may set their own schedules, working part-time or full-time based on their preferences. Rideshare drivers are responsible for maintaining their vehicles, providing good customer service, and adhering to local transportation regulations.
